Default 4.10 question

i am not too knowledgeable on truck internals. so it may sound like a stupid question. if i change my 3.73 gears to a 4.10, how does that affect the truck when i switch to 4wd? is the any modifications i need to do to the front differentials?


also, how do you like the 4.10 gears? is it worth the $$$? how much is a good price? would it be a good mod with a TC?

you will need to change the front diff over to 4.10's too...if you don't the front wheels and the rear wheels will be turning at different speeds when in 4x4...and that's BAD

the change from 3.73's to 4.10's in my opinion is not worth the price that you will pay........not enought of a performance gain for the money
